Buckman Springs Rd & Freedom Ranch is a serene retreat nestled in Campo, CA, offering a range of outdoor activities and accommodations for visitors seeking a peaceful escape.
With its scenic surroundings and tranquil atmosphere, this destination provides a place for individuals and families to unwind and connect with nature.
Generated from their business information